Home
last modified time | relevance | path

Searched refs:nv_connector (Results 1 – 4 of 4) sorted by relevance

/Linux-v5.4/drivers/gpu/drm/nouveau/
Dnouveau_connector.c398 struct nouveau_connector *nv_connector = nouveau_connector(connector); in nouveau_connector_destroy() local
399 nvif_notify_fini(&nv_connector->hpd); in nouveau_connector_destroy()
400 kfree(nv_connector->edid); in nouveau_connector_destroy()
403 if (nv_connector->aux.transfer) { in nouveau_connector_destroy()
404 drm_dp_cec_unregister_connector(&nv_connector->aux); in nouveau_connector_destroy()
405 drm_dp_aux_unregister(&nv_connector->aux); in nouveau_connector_destroy()
406 kfree(nv_connector->aux.name); in nouveau_connector_destroy()
461 struct nouveau_connector *nv_connector = nouveau_connector(connector); in nouveau_connector_of_detect() local
476 nv_connector->edid = in nouveau_connector_of_detect()
490 struct nouveau_connector *nv_connector = nouveau_connector(connector); in nouveau_connector_set_encoder() local
[all …]
Dnouveau_connector.h101 struct nouveau_connector *nv_connector = NULL; in nouveau_crtc_connector_get() local
107 nv_connector = nouveau_connector(connector); in nouveau_crtc_connector_get()
113 return nv_connector; in nouveau_crtc_connector_get()
/Linux-v5.4/drivers/gpu/drm/nouveau/dispnv04/
Ddfp.c187 struct nouveau_connector *nv_connector = nouveau_encoder_connector_get(nv_encoder); in nv04_dfp_mode_fixup() local
189 if (!nv_connector->native_mode || in nv04_dfp_mode_fixup()
190 nv_connector->scaling_mode == DRM_MODE_SCALE_NONE || in nv04_dfp_mode_fixup()
191 mode->hdisplay > nv_connector->native_mode->hdisplay || in nv04_dfp_mode_fixup()
192 mode->vdisplay > nv_connector->native_mode->vdisplay) { in nv04_dfp_mode_fixup()
196 nv_encoder->mode = *nv_connector->native_mode; in nv04_dfp_mode_fixup()
197 adjusted_mode->clock = nv_connector->native_mode->clock; in nv04_dfp_mode_fixup()
289 struct nouveau_connector *nv_connector = nouveau_crtc_connector_get(nv_crtc); in nv04_dfp_mode_set() local
292 struct drm_connector *connector = &nv_connector->base; in nv04_dfp_mode_set()
331 if (nv_connector->scaling_mode == DRM_MODE_SCALE_NONE || in nv04_dfp_mode_set()
[all …]
/Linux-v5.4/drivers/gpu/drm/nouveau/dispnv50/
Ddisp.c356 struct nouveau_connector *nv_connector = in nv50_outp_atomic_check() local
359 nv_connector->native_mode); in nv50_outp_atomic_check()
496 struct nouveau_connector *nv_connector; in nv50_audio_enable() local
503 u8 data[sizeof(nv_connector->base.eld)]; in nv50_audio_enable()
512 nv_connector = nouveau_encoder_connector_get(nv_encoder); in nv50_audio_enable()
513 if (!drm_detect_monitor_audio(nv_connector->edid)) in nv50_audio_enable()
516 memcpy(args.data, nv_connector->base.eld, sizeof(args.data)); in nv50_audio_enable()
564 struct nouveau_connector *nv_connector; in nv50_hdmi_enable() local
574 nv_connector = nouveau_encoder_connector_get(nv_encoder); in nv50_hdmi_enable()
575 if (!drm_detect_hdmi_monitor(nv_connector->edid)) in nv50_hdmi_enable()
[all …]